Description

"Heroes of the Middle Ages" offers a great way to introduce elementary to junior high aged children to that time period. Even those who find history boring will enjoy sharing this little find with young historians. Much of the history learned in school is fragmented, offering little in the way of making connections and showing relationships between people groups and nations. The whole purpose of this short historical introduction is to do just that--weave a tapestry of connections between the rise and fall of nations during the Middle Ages. You will find the connection between the fall of Rome and the invading barbarians. You'll be given a brief introduction to the forming of Germanic nations, the Teutonic invasions, the Crusades, the discoverers, as well as a look into the struggles of the nations during this time. Don't pick this up expecting a deep biographical sketch of Charlemagne or Joan of Arc. Know that you'll be getting a basic account of their importance in history. Hopefully, this text will whet your appetite and challenge you to study further.
